Summary of role:
As part of the Supply Chain team, the Material Handler will manage the whole process of material handling and inventory management at the Hazel Grove site from first receipt of goods, to recording, storage and allocation into finished products and finally despatch.
Key tasks:
1. Inventory Handling – Store raw materials or components. Maintain stock levels and update records.
2. Issuing Materials – Pick and issue materials to production based on requirements. Ensure correct stock allocation and move to assembly area
3. Packaging Product Ready for Despatch – Securely pack finished goods according to specifications, ensuring protection and compliance.
4. Obtain Quotes – Source and compare freight/shipping costs, selecting the best option for efficiency and cost-effectiveness.
5. Documents for Logistics – Prepare shipping documents, labels, and necessary customs paperwork (if applicable).
6. Despatched Finished Products – Arrange carrier collection, confirm shipment, and update records to track delivery status.
Typical duties:
7. Work closely with the Supply Chain team to ascertain and maintain all critical stock levels
8. As required, raise and issue requisitions for stocked parts
9. Follow quarantine procedure for all necessary goods inwards, working with Quality team in accordance with company and compliance requirements
10. Unload incoming deliveries with FLT where necessary
11. Maintain and update all stock records in the business system.
12. Receive and record all goods inwards, create GRN’s and secure items to stores.
13. Record all Supplier Certificates of Conformity to the ERP system
14. Update and sign off Process pack with all orders
15. Liaise with the Assembly team regarding job kitting and scheduling
16. Kit jobs into job bins ready for manufacture, noting and actioning any shortages
17. Maintain batch numbers of stock and ensure their use in rotation
18. On job completion, receipt job for despatch complete with batch information
19. Maintain sign off procedure for all cartons despatched with AM
20. Carry out all duties in accordance with the company’s QHSE policies and procedures.
